Magali Ranchou‐Peyruse is a scholar working on Environmental Chemistry, Ecology and Environmental Engineering. According to data from OpenAlex, Magali Ranchou‐Peyruse has authored 21 papers receiving a total of 400 indexed citations (citations by other indexed papers that have themselves been cited), including 12 papers in Environmental Chemistry, 10 papers in Ecology and 9 papers in Environmental Engineering. Recurrent topics in Magali Ranchou‐Peyruse’s work include Methane Hydrates and Related Phenomena (10 papers), Microbial Community Ecology and Physiology (9 papers) and CO2 Sequestration and Geologic Interactions (8 papers). Magali Ranchou‐Peyruse is often cited by papers focused on Methane Hydrates and Related Phenomena (10 papers), Microbial Community Ecology and Physiology (9 papers) and CO2 Sequestration and Geologic Interactions (8 papers). Magali Ranchou‐Peyruse collaborates with scholars based in France, Morocco and United Kingdom. Magali Ranchou‐Peyruse's co-authors include Anthony Ranchou‐Peyruse, Pierre Chiquet, Rémy Guyoneaud, Guilhem Caumette and Pierre Cézac and has published in prestigious journals such as Energy & Environmental Science, The Science of The Total Environment and Environmental Pollution.
